About the Role
The Healthy Eating Unit seeks an enthusiastic and detail-oriented individual to assist with implementing the Get the Good Stuff program, including program promotion, recruitment, enrollment, and survey administration. This position will primarily occur at supermarkets across NYC, with periodic visits to the NYC Health Department office in Long Island City, Queens, for data entry and other projects as needed. This is a temporary part-time role, 21 hours over 3 days weekly.
Responsibilities
- Conduct site visits at supermarkets across diverse communities and populations in NYC.
- Promote the program at participating supermarkets, including explaining how the program works and answering questions.
- Enroll eligible customers and track daily enrollment numbers.
- Enter participant enrollment data into Microsoft Excel.
- Assist with training supermarket staff on how to promote the program.
- Conduct participant surveys at supermarkets as needed.
- Ensure stock of program materials at participating supermarkets.
- Attend outreach events such as community health fairs to promote Get the Good Stuff.
- Assist with identification of potential outreach partners such as community-based organizations and SNAP enrollment centers.

About the Company
- The Fund for Public Health in New York City (FPHNYC) is a 501(c)3 non-profit organization that is dedicated to the advancement of the health and well-being of all New Yorkers.
- In partnership with the New York City Department of Health and Mental Hygiene (DOHMH), FPHNYC incubates innovative public health initiatives implemented by DOHMH to advance community health throughout the city.
- It facilitates partnerships, often new and unconventional, between government and the private sector to develop, test, and launch new initiatives.
- These collaborations speed the execution of demonstration projects, effect expansion of successful pilot programs, and support rapid implementation to meet the public health needs of individuals, families, and communities across New York City.
